Structures of trehalose-6-phosphate synthase, Tps1, from the fungal pathogen Cryptococcus neoformans : A target for antifungals

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ences of the United States of America. 2022-11; 
Erica J. Washington; Ye Zhou; Allen L. Hsu; Matthew Petrovich; Jennifer L. Tenor; Dena L. Toffaletti; Ziqiang Guan; John R. Perfect; Mario J. Borgnia; Alberto Bartesaghi; Richard G. Brennan

SignificanceFungal infections are responsible for over a million deaths worldwide each year. Biosynthesis of a disaccharide, trehalose, is required for multiple pathogenic fungi to transition from the environment to the human host. Enzymes in the trehalose biosynthesis pathway are absent in humans and, therefore, are potentially significant targets for antifungal therapeutics. One enzyme in the trehalose biosynthesis is trehalose-6-phosphate synthase (Tps1). Here, we describe the cryoelectron microscopy structures of the CnTps1 homotetramer in the unliganded form and in complex with a substrate and a product.
